About

Niagara Day Tour offers guided day trips from downtown Toronto (departing near Bremner Boulevard/Rogers Centre area) to Niagara Falls. With a 4.8 Google rating, they're among the higher-rated Niagara tour operators serving the Toronto market.

The standard tour covers the major Niagara Falls viewpoints, including Table Rock where you stand right at the edge of Horseshoe Falls, and often includes the Hornblower Niagara Cruises boat ride. The boat takes you into the spray zone at the base of the Falls — easily the most thrilling part of the trip for kids and adults alike. Most tours also stop at Niagara-on-the-Lake for a break.

The experience is similar across Niagara tour operators, so what differentiates them is guide quality, group size, and what's included in the price. Niagara Day Tour runs smaller groups, which means more personal attention and a better experience for families who don't want to be anonymous faces on a giant tour bus.

The day is long — plan for 8-10 hours round trip. The drive from Toronto is about 90 minutes each way via the QEW. For families with young children (under 5), this is a lot of time in a vehicle. Bring tablets, books, and snacks. For kids 5+, the payoff at the Falls makes the drive worthwhile.

The Falls operate year-round, but the boat rides are seasonal (roughly May-November). Summer is the most popular time with the longest lines. Spring and fall offer comfortable weather with smaller crowds.

Why Kids Love It

The power of Niagara Falls is something kids have to experience in person — no video does it justice. The boat ride into the mist is the ultimate highlight. The drive through wine country and the stop at the cute town of Niagara-on-the-Lake add variety to the day.

Pro Tips from Parents

  • The Hornblower boat ride is the highlight — make sure it's included or budget for it separately
  • Bring a rain poncho or plan to get soaked on the boat ride
  • Pack tablets and headphones for kids during the drive
  • Visit on a weekday for shorter lines at every attraction
  • Ask your guide about Journey Behind the Falls — walking through tunnels behind the waterfall is memorable for older kids

What to Bring

  • Rain poncho or waterproof jacket
  • Extra set of dry clothes
  • Snacks and entertainment for the drive
  • Waterproof phone case for the boat ride
  • Comfortable walking shoes
